Like septic tanks, these outdated style units still call for care and routine maintenance, but there are marked distinctions between the two. The major difference is that your pit won’t have a leach field to disseminate effluent into the soil. It absorbs through the walls instead. The solids will still build up eventually, though, which means cesspool pumping in South Byron NY homes and businesses is an absolute must to avoid spoiling the land and local water, in addition to prevent getting a nasty backup in your building.

1 Figure out the Specific Location and Condition of Your Cesspool
Most of the existing laws prevent new units from being installed, so it’s quite likely that you have a wastewater treatment pit that’s over forty years old if your home or business has one of these. For this reason, it might not be easy to find and property documents may not even indicate one is present. You need to have an inspector out to inspect yours to make sure it’s in good condition. If you do not know where it is, the inspector can help you find it.
2. Block Off the Location
Because effluent leaks through the wall surfaces of the pit, the surrounding ground can become quite waterlogged. Moreover, the older structures become delicate in time, which makes them hazardous. Cave-ins happen, and they’re often deadly, so see to it the area is isolated to prevent access. Massive things like vehicles are likely to cause a problem, but even a wandering young child or pet can cause a wall or lid to crumble.
